Food and beverages must be kept in the rented room or space. Food and beverages are not allowed in the theater or dance studio. All requests to use the lobby for catering must be approved in writing. The Hopkins Center for the Arts reserves the right to coordinate and determine the number and placement of catering stations in the lobby or other common use areas. Requests to use the lobby for catering stations must be made in writing 30 days prior to the event.

If you are not having a cash bar or charging admission to your event you can select a caterer of your choice, as long as they can provide a copy of their license and liability insurance. If the renting organization / individual would like to have a cash bar to serve alcohol, or to charge admission to an event, the renting organization / individual is required to hire the services of one of the Arts Center approved caterers. This caterer must provide both the food and alcohol. Please request this list if you will be serving alcohol at a cash bar.

Caterers are responsible for all table coverings. Caterers are also expected to provide all plates, silverware, and glassware for tables.
All payments must be made prior to the start of the event.
